How Advanced Materials Enhance Wearability in Outdoor Conditions
Advanced materials are revolutionizing outdoor gear. They boost comfort and durability in tough conditions. Lighter fabrics are now more tear and water-resistant. Breathable membranes help regulate body temperature. Stretchable materials allow for better movement. Quick-dry tech keeps adventurers dry. UV-blocking fabrics protect against harmful rays. Antimicrobial treatments reduce odor build-up. These innovations make outdoor clothing more efficient for survival and recreation.

Eco-Friendly Practices in Survival Gear Manufacturing
The trend in outdoor gear is going green. Brands now focus on reducing harm to the environment. They use sustainable materials like organic cotton and recycled polyester in their products. Even the dyes and treatments are eco-friendly, causing less pollution. Factories are powered with renewable energy. This cuts down on carbon footprints. Packaging is minimal and biodegradable. Producers also support local communities where they operate. All these steps show a commitment to making earth-friendly survival gear.
Ethical Sourcing and Production Transparency in the Industry
The outdoor gear world is changing. More companies now focus on ethical sourcing. They want to ensure their products cause no harm. 'Transparency' is their new mantra. They show where and how products are made. This builds trust with consumers. Often, they use ethical labels or certifications. These confirm fair labor and safe factories. They also avoid materials from high-risk areas. It's part of a push for more moral gear production. This trend is growing in the US as buyers seek to make responsible choices.
